White House Announces Key AI Actions Following October Executive Order

January 29, 2024

United StatesU.S. Executive Branch

Summary

On January 29, 2024, Deputy Chief of Staff Bruce Reed convened the White House AI Council to review the progress made by different federal departments and agencies on their 90-day actions tasked by the AI EO. The departments and agencies reported that they have completed all of their 90-day actions and advanced other directives with later deadlines. Actions the government has taken to manage AI risks and promote the safe innovation of AI include: • The U.S. National Science Foundation (NSF) launching a pilot of the National AI Research Resource (NAIRR) to deliver computing power, data, software, access to open and proprietary AI models, and other AI training resources to researchers and students. • The AI and Tech Talent Task Force launching an AI Talent Surge to hire AI professionals across the federal government, including through a large-scale hiring action for data scientists. • The NSF beginning the EducateAI initiative to help fund educators creating high-quality, inclusive AI educational opportunities at the K-12 through undergraduate levels. • The NSF announcing funding of new Regional Innovation Engines (NSF Engines), including a focus on advancing AI. • The Department of Health and Human Services establishing an AI Task Force to develop policies with the goal of providing regulatory clarity and catalyzing AI innovation in health care.
